The extensibility parameter D is interpreted in the sense that up to D (or 1 to D) dot characters between two consecutive solid characters are allowed. The output is all maximal extensible (with D spacers) patterns that occur at least K times in s. Incidentally, the algorithm can be adapted to extract rigid motifs as a special case. For this, it suffices to interpret D as the maximum number of dot characters between two consecutive solid characters.